example.blade.phpは表示されるのですが、exaplechild.blade.phpはブラウザで真っ白な表示になってしまいます。
URLはhomestead.app/dashboard/example
と、homestead.app/dashboard/example/examplechildになります
routes.blade.phpには、 */
Route::group(['prefix' => 'dashboard'], function(){
Route::resource('example', 'ExampleController');
});
とあり、ExampleControllerには
class ExampleController extends Controller
{
public function __construct()
{
//$this->middleware('auth');
}
protected function validator(array $data)
{
return Validator::make($data, [
'project_id' => 'required',
'title' => 'required',
'user_id' => 'required',
]);
}
function index(Request $request)
{
if ($request->user())
{
$users = User::all();
if ( $request->ajax() ) {
return ['data' => $users];
}
return view('home.example.index', compact('users'));
}
}
public function examplechild()
{
return view('home.example.examplechild');
}
}
Controllerのindexやexamplechildの記述が変なのでしょうか?
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。